The Benefits Of Lyo Solutions For Pharmaceutical Industries

lyo solutions, also known as lyophilization, is a crucial process used in the pharmaceutical industry to preserve and extend the shelf life of various products. This innovative technology involves freeze-drying products to remove water content, thereby enhancing their stability and making them less susceptible to degradation. Lyophilization is widely utilized in the production of vaccines, antibiotics, enzymes, and other biopharmaceuticals. In this article, we will discuss the numerous benefits of lyo solutions for pharmaceutical industries.

One of the primary advantages of lyo solutions is its ability to significantly extend the shelf life of pharmaceutical products. By removing water through freeze-drying, lyophilized products remain stable at room temperature for an extended period. This increased shelf life allows for easier storage, transportation, and distribution of pharmaceuticals, ultimately reducing the risk of product waste and cost associated with spoilage.
